    V. SCARCE AUSTRALIAN ASSOCIATED 1821 BRITISH CAVALRY OFFICER'S SWORD
    beautiful 34¼" blade etched with ROYAL CYPHER VR, acanthus leaf decoration & #23649 to back edge; Prince of Wales feathers, BY APPOINTMENT & HENRY WILKINSON PALL MALL LONDON to ricasso; obverse side, Battle Honours, PENINSULA, WATERLOO, ALMA, BALAKLAVA, SEVASTAPOL, INKERMAN in banners, centred between the banner sunburst Royal Cypher, 13 & motto VIRET IN A ETERNUM, also, family crest of William A. Thompson of the 13th Hussars & other crests; std 3 bar hilt with grey finish; vg fish skin grips bound with woven silver wire; complete with correct, plated steel scabbard. A beautiful sword. William A. Thompson was A.D.C. for the Governor of Sth Australia from 1889-1891.
